Book Hero Magic formatted this description to make it easier to read. While it's new and still learning, it may not be perfect - your feedback is welcome! Description

Between 2005 to 2007, the international documentary photographer Debby Besford researched and photographed a complexity of issues around the representation of the contemporary female, with emphasis on the Burlesque Stage Performer. This led onto further creative intrigue and a questioning of the idea of play between photographer, private space, intimacy, fantasy and the real, and the mystique of the performer.

This particular body of work evolved from a deep-rooted curiosity about female sexuality, and how it can be expressed and represented in a positive and more complex way.

Inside the Burlesque Boudoir explores these themes and offers readers a unique insight into the world of burlesque through Debby Besford's lens.

About the Author

Debby Besford is a highly established Documentary photographer who lives in Norfolk, UK. Her work showcases a rich and diverse portfolio of images specializing in, Editorial, and Documentary. Debby has travelled to many countries, including, East Africa, Moscow, USA, India, and Spain, to work on personal projects that all started from a deep desire to explore the people, their lives and environments. These projects have been exhibited across the UK and Europe and published in national newspapers and magazines as well as online publications. "Being involved as a documentary photographer for me, is a genuine desire and curiosity to creatively encapsulate and communicate to an audience." - Debby Besford
